KASUR (Dunya News) – Chief Justice of Lahore High Court (LHC) Manzoor Ahmed Malik on Tuesday has summoned Inspector General (IG), Home Secretary and Prosecutor General Punjab tomorrow for hearing Kasur Child abuse case in Anti-Terrorism Court (ATC).

As per details, the case was heard by CJ Manzoor Ahmed during which the counsel told the court that there is no provision of terrorism in Kasur child abuse case. He said that the incident has created an environment of fear among the locals, therefore, the authorities should include provision of terrorism in FIR.

Subsequently, CJ has approved the plea admissible and called on authorities into the matter.
